11 AC TIVE HOLIDAYS Fabriano Arrival in the Afternoon in Fabriano and accommodation in a hotel. Then, you move to a craftman’s studio to attend a papermaking workshop. You create your own paper sheet. At the end, you go back to the hotel. Dinner and overnight stay. Fabriano After the breakfast, you go to a pork-butcher’s. The craftman teaches how the famous salami is produced. Lunch in the typical restaurant, attached to the pork-butcher’s . In the afternoon, you have a walk around the charming Fabriano. Later you go back to the hotel to attend a cooking workshop at the restaurant into the hotel. At the end, dinner and overnight stay. Morro d’Alba After the breakfast, transfer to Morro d’Alba, one of the most beautiful villages in the Marches, famous for its wine, the Lacrima. You visit the magic old town and the Utensilia Museum that tells about the sharecropping. Then, you go to a farm to learn about wine and oil production. Later you have a taste of some typical products. Cart oceto, Pergola, Macerata Feltria Arrival in the morning in Cartoceto. You have a tour to discover the village and its famous oil trees and mills. You learn about oil production during a typical lunch. Between October and November you can also see the olive picking. In the afternoon, you move to Pergola to visit the famous Gilded Bronzes. This is the only Gilded Bronzes group dating from Ancient Roman times still remaining in the world. Then you move to Macerata Feltria. Dinner and overnight stay in a charming dwelling. Urbania, Peglio After the breakfast, you move to the village of Peglio and then to Urbania. Along its ancient streets you can breathe History and the Palazzo Ducale is an absolute renaissance masterpiece. But its Ceramics craft tradition is also famous and still lasts in the town. You can experience the technical and aesthetics knowledge during a ceramics art and decoration workshop. Lunch on your own. At the end you go back to Macerata Feltria for dinner and overnight stay. Macerata Feltria After the breakfast, you can attend one of some interesting workshops: Italian or Medieval cooking, embroidery or a lesson about Montefeltro’s History.
